Born from the exigency to replace traditional rubber hoses, the 3 16 thermoplastic hose stands distinguished in terms of design and function. Its core composition includes several layers of synthetic polymers selected for their endurance and unwavering chemical resistance. This composition ensures that the hose remains impervious to various industrial fluids, making it a versatile choice for multiple applications ranging from hydraulic machinery to chemical plants.
